Cost of Residential Roof Replacement in Springfield, MA
Residential roof replacement costs in Springfield, MA typically vary based on the scope of the project, chosen materials, labor requirements, and site-specific conditions. Factors such as roof size, complexity, and accessibility can influence overall pricing. It is common for final costs to differ from initial estimates due to these variables.
Potential homeowners should consider that material selection, including asphalt shingles, metal, or other options, impacts the overall expense. Additionally, site conditions such as existing roof state and structural considerations can affect labor and material costs. Comparing different options and obtaining detailed quotes can help in understanding the range of possible expenses for residential roof replacement projects in Springfield, MA.

Replacing a residential roof in Springfield, MA involves several key considerations that can impact the overall project. Understanding typical scope, materials, and permitting requirements can help homeowners plan effectively for this important upgrade.
- Materials commonly used include asphalt shingles, metal panels, and architectural shingles, each offering different durability and aesthetic options.
- The size and complexity of the roof, such as steep slopes or multiple levels, influence the scope and labor involved.
- Labor complexity varies based on roof design, accessibility, and existing structural conditions, affecting installation time and effort.
- Permitting requirements in Springfield usually involve building permits to ensure compliance with local codes and regulations.
- Additional options may include roof vents, skylights, or insulation upgrades, which can add to the overall project scope and cost.
